Iowa tight end T.J. Hockenson, who seemed destined for Jacksonville before Josh Allen went to the Jaguars, went at the 8th pick, one spot later, to Detroit.
Hockenson is an all-around tight end, with blocking skills, speed and savvy. He finds open areas in defenses and doesn’t drop the ball.
He caught 49 passes for 760 yards and six touchdowns for the Iowa Hawkeyes last season.
